Use AI to simulate patient or peer feedback on your draft notes to spot unclear or sensitive content.
After drafting a clinical note, referral letter, or patient instruction, ask AI to role-play as a patient, colleague, or reviewer giving feedback. This lets you catch language that might confuse patients, miss key details, or sound unprofessional before anyone else sees it. By simulating different perspectives—like a worried patient or a busy specialist—you can identify gaps or tone issues you might miss on your own. Always remember to review and adjust AI suggestions carefully and never share real patient data with the AI.
Try this prompt today
“Act as a patient reading this instruction letter: [paste your draft here]. Tell me any parts that seem confusing, unclear, or could cause worry. Suggest simpler ways to explain or improve the tone.”
